It was good to be using some braincells again, it felt like scraping the dust from my thinking-neurons. I think this puzzle game was more difficult than the other puzzle games of this developer, though I found the solving process less satisfying than Hexcells. Most levels took me longer than I expected, but they were all solvable with logic. Some levels required ten minutes of staring before the solution hit, but it felt great when it worked out.
CrossCells is made by the same developer behind the Hexcells series and SquareCells. Unfortunately, it feels like a downgrade compared to their previous work. There's no dark mode or level reset option, and the puzzles don't tell you if you've made a mistake. This becomes a issue in the later levels, as there can be multiple valid solutions in any given row or column, which can lead you down the wrong path. Ultimately, solving the puzzles don't feel as satisfying as it did in Hexcells or SquareCells. I don't recommend getting this game unless you pick it up as part of the Logic Puzzle Pack.

I would have to say that this game is the best out of the developer's logic games series. The game is about making numbers add up to the given requirements, which allows for more interesting combinations. The operations are carried out from left to right, allowing multiplication cells to create asymmetric totals. The only issue I have is that the game does not give instant feedback on whether a choice is right, and there is no reset button when you find out you do mess out (exiting and re-entering works though). I would recommend this game to anyone looking for a puzzle game to play.
Really neutral on this one. It's quite satisfying to solve the puzzle and figure it out, but levels rarely allow you to get into 'flow' of actually SOLVING the puzzle. I would say around 25% of this game is just a tutorial or demonstration, 25% has some really good levels, 25% is average, and another 25% is just extremely hard and frustrating. The difficulty curve is very nonlinear and I found myself just jumping back and fourth. There were a couple levels that I had to go back to and had a great time, and others that I spent multiple days and sessions trying to figure out what the 'path' to solving a level was and couldn't crack it. When looking up a guide for those levels...it felt like I was already close enough to the solution, like "didn't I try that combination already?" Which is a big letdown.
